LH-Induced MAPK Activation Is Reduced in Areg−/− Egfrwa2/wa2 Preovulatory Follicles
LH-induced MAPK phosphorylation was analyzed by Western blot using proteins extracted from wild-type (Areg+/+ Egfr+/+), Areg+/+ Egfrwa2/wa2, and Areg−/− Egfrwa2/wa2 POFs that were cultured in the absence or presence of 5 IU rLH for 2 h. The ratios of phosphorylated MAPK to total MAPK levels were normalized to the wild-type level after 2 h rLH stimulation. Data represent the mean ± sem of five separate experiments. *, P < 0.001.
